Special awards were presented at a recent Awards Night at Victory Christian School according to Principal Jim Petersen.
Sarah Stallings received a MVP trophy for her performance in the Victory Challenge Basketball Invitational Tournament. Summer McMahan was awarded a trophy for being selected to the NCCSA 1-A All-State Girls’ Basketball Team. Brayden McMahan received a trophy for being selected to the NCCSA 1-A All-State Boys’ Basketball Team at the same meeting.
Students earning an “A” average received a medal and certificate for their Academic Excellence.
